Output efbf04abae865d7d19686ba22a358d20941cac842cd2dcd6cbf6b2c52888cd7f:2

value
100000
script pubkey
OP_0 OP_PUSHBYTES_20 ba2fcda95b5092e4013d9ee2be6b699ca2913a3f
address
bc1qhghum22m2zfwgqfanm3tu6mfnj3fzw3lsdxq0h
transaction
efbf04abae865d7d19686ba22a358d20941cac842cd2dcd6cbf6b2c52888cd7f
confirmations
174969
spent
true